DESCRIPTION:
Series S2000 are for measuring fan and blower pressures, filter resistance, furnace draft, pressure drop across orifice plates, monitoring blood and respiratory pressures in medical care equipment with simple, frictionless movement parts. It can resist shock, vibration and over-pressures.
PRESSURE LIMITS: -20Hg to 15 psi (-0.677 bar to 1.0344 bar)
ACCURACY: 2% full scale
PROCESS CONNECTIONS: 1/8 female NPT duplicate high and low pressure taps- one pair side and one pair back.
WARRANTY: 1 yrs
ACCESSORIES: 2 1/8 NPT barbed fittings, two 1/8NPT plugs, and three mounting tabs and screws.
